Immunotherapy is an option where allergy shots help your body get used to allergens, the things that trigger an allergic reaction. They don’t cure allergies, but eventually your symptoms will get better and you may not have allergic reactions as often.  May work for you if allergy drugs don’t work well or you have symptoms more than three months a year.Consult physician in allergy clinic.
